Output 6f8e66cfa8232a59a3047a1ebe2c54d058b2887ca14df3581d6e388219f2b2e7:7

value
1162286
script pubkey
OP_0 OP_PUSHBYTES_32 8703df59a385e96083946138fb2bcf7dc1a73eaec8335668591a8a6ce5644824
address
bc1qsupa7kdrsh5kpqu5vyu0k2700hq6w04weqe4v6zer29xeetyfqjqmhktdr
transaction
6f8e66cfa8232a59a3047a1ebe2c54d058b2887ca14df3581d6e388219f2b2e7
spent
true